Beyond this Drip: Advanced Leak Investigation Techniques

Pinpointing a leak can be get more info challenging, especially when the issue is subtle. While traditional methods like visual inspection and pressure testing are valuable, advanced leak investigation techniques offer a deeper dive. These sophisticated approaches leverage technology to locate even the tiniest of leaks, providing accurate data for effective repair.

  • Acoustic Emission Sensors: These sensors listen sounds generated by escaping fluids, allowing technicians to pinpoint leak locations with remarkable accuracy.
  • Infrared Imaging Cameras: These cameras detect temperature differences, revealing leaks as areas of heat. They are particularly effective for detecting leaks in confined spaces.
  • Gas Tracing Techniques: Specialized gases are introduced into the system, and then detected to identify the leak source. This method is excellent for complex systems with multiple sections

By incorporating these advanced techniques, professionals can solve leaks more efficiently, minimizing downtime and costs.
